July 10, 1935 - June 17, 2017

Harvey Dean Bailey, 81, passed away June 17, 2017 at his home in Conway, Arkansas. He was born July 10, 1935 in Oakland, Iowa, to the late Leon and Anna (Kearnes) Bailey.

As a 1954 graduate of Thomas Jefferson High School in Council Bluffs, Iowa, he was an active member of ROTC, serving on the Honor Guard for Vice President Richard M. Nixon. On March 7, 1961, he married the love of his life, Virginia (Roberson) Bailey in Omaha, Nebraska. Together, the couple raised 7 children, James, Ronald, Stephen, Kenneth, Sharon, Connie and Dean. Harvey worked for the Union Pacific Railroad for 35 years, retiring in 1990 as a District Foreman. He was an active member in the Eastern Stars, Masons and Shriners, holding several positions of honor through many years. He also enjoyed spending time with his family, camping, playing bridge, golfing and traveling.

In addition to his parents, Harvey was preceded in death by his brother, Wayne Bailey; grandsons, Eric Bauman, Jonathan Stanton, and Weston Bailey; Sister-in-law, Eugenia Roberson; nephew, Thomas Marsh; and great-nephew Devin Sutton.

Harvey is survived by his wife of 56 years, Vinnie Virginia Bailey, of Conway; children James (Tracey) Stanton of Ammon, Idaho; Ronald (Sue) Bailey of Omaha, Nebraska; Stephen (Patricia) Stanton of Conway; Kenneth (Holly) Stanton of Yermo, California; Sharon (Greg) Bauman of Pocatello, Idaho; Connie (Steven) Wondel of Las Vegas, Nevada; Dean (Vikki) Bailey of Kuna, Idaho, 13 grandchildren and 6 great-grandchildren, and special Niece, Eileen (Ron) Sutton of Odebolt, Iowa.
